Hi all,
I planned to integrate JForum into my site, though it looks like I will rather have to integrate my site into JForum, by the looks of it.
Really good work so far.
I am wondering if there's any sort of architectural overview of the code somewhere? I see the JForum class is the central servlet, which doles out its reply template based on the action name of the form submit, but it's a lot to take in. Does anyone have like an idiots guide to adding a new Action from start to finish? Or a new Entity?
For example, I will need to modify the users/profiles to have an image associated with them, so I'll need to modify the whole chain up the stack, which would be easier if there were a guide of sorts, written by one of the main devs?
Thanks
Dan

I'm afraid there is no such guide available.
With respect to the image, are you aware of the built-in avatar functionality? It lets each user upload an image which is then displayed alongside their profile (and next to each of their posts).
